Hormones and sylleptic branching

Sylleptic branches grow out from buds immediately without overwintering. Although this is relatively rare in temperate woody species, it does occur in economically important hybrid poplar. Cline and Dong-Il (pp. 417-421) present preliminary evidence of a correlation between differences in sensitivity to auxin and cytokinin and the degree of sylleptic branching.
